When you were in diapers, Ken, I stopped in Rome, shopping the stores for handbags to be copied in Colombia or the USA. This nice young woman and male friend stopped me and asked if I knew where Armani was sold (this was before he had his own stores). I told them to go to Fendi and ask. An hour later, I was in the "happening" shoe store, when Olivia and Matt came in, Matt sporting an olive aniline-dyed leather jacket with an Armani insignia the size of a basketball on the back. We chatted some more -- she was still so nice-- and I bought the stupid unisex boots that the store was touting, just to be cool and chat more. 40 years later, the unworn (too fruity) boots went to Goodwill.
